Nagaland Taekwondo wins 3 medals at sub-junior nationals

Medal winners of the 4th Sub-Junior National Taekwondo Championship with coaches and Manager at the Jawaharlal Nehru Indoor Stadium, Cuttack, Odisha on August 30.

KOHIMA, AUGUST 30 (MExN): The Nagaland Taekwondo Association (NTA) put up a commendable performance at the 4th Sub-Junior National Taekwondo Championship held at the Jawaharlal Nehru Indoor Stadium, Cuttack, Odisha, from August 28 to 30.

The team, led by coaches Visabiu Peseyie and Santsuthung Ngullie with T Alem Aier as team manager, competed in six weight categories in the Sub-Junior Boys Division and returned with two gold medals and one silver.

Shiusuthong clinched the gold in the 35 kg category, defeating opponents from Maharashtra, Haryana, Telangana and Bihar in the final. In the 29 kg category, Sudeh Lamliu secured another gold, overcoming players from Rajasthan, Sikkim, Tamil Nadu, Puducherry and Uttarakhand in the final. Iciheing Ndang won silver in the 50 kg category, after victories over Punjab and Maharashtra, before going down to Uttar Pradesh in the final.
